Grooming / Maintenance Opportunity

Fall | 2024


.....As one door closes, another opens though big shoes will be required to fill it! Our Board will be working to create an official posting for a "Grooming / Maintenance" position, but we are also keenly aware that some Members might be interested in helping execute the key functions either in a volunteer or paid capacity. It could be one person full-time or multiple persons, part-time. Some key areas of responsibility are: snow grooming, winter lodge opening and checking / fire building, snow clearing, basic equipment preventative repair and maintenance, fuel procurement, scheduling key support services (propane, dumpster, sewage pump out), summer lease and building checks, off season trail maintenance (clearing windfall, mowing, collecting firewood, changing trail lights, etc). If you are willing to support the Club with any of the identified functions please contact us.

Safe Sport - NEW!

Ongoing in 2024 |


WNSC is in the process of adopting the Safe Sport Policies and Practices that are endorsed by the Provincial and National Sport Organizations that we are associated with. The policies are intended to promote a Safe Sport environment in a manner that allows for consistent, immediate, appropriate and meaningful action should any issues arise, and they are also intended to prevent issues from arising in the first place by communicating expected standards of behaviour. Watch for ongoing updates.

Stay Safe! Be BearSmart

Summer / Fall 2024 |


When using our trails, please remember that you are recreating in a wildlife corridor! Make noise, travel in a group carry bear spray somewhere accessible and know how to use it! The Club is not able to report all sightings so trail users travel at their own risk.
